    Grammarly is an application or extension for your browser that checks grammar, spelling, punctuation, and sentence structure. It also has a plagiarism detector that checks over 16 billion web pages.  With this English spell checker, you will be able to write emails, contracts, and all kinds of texts in English correctly and in a very simple way.

Why is this particular tool or technology relevant to teaching writing purposes?

Grammarly software is effective to help teachers and learners in correcting EFL writing. It is because Grammarly is not only able to identify punctuation (such as the missing spaces after the periods) and the spelling mistakes, including the proper noun and provided several alternative possibilities for the misspelled words, but also identify fragments and offer advice on verb form, although often no suggested corrections are presented, and explanations were complex (Daniels & Leslie, 2013).    If you are studying English this tool will help you to check the grammar of your texts as it will explain the mistakes you are doing, so it will not only help you to correct but also learn in the process. What limitations can you see with the use of this technology for the purposes of language learning?

    The development of the writing skill not only consists in technical aspects such as punctuation and use of grammatical structures properly, but it is also about the ability to bring cohesion, consistency, progression, and creativity to the writing process. Those aspects are referred to metacognition skills in students.Thus, having that in mind, this app can only contribute to improve a 50% of the students' work regarded the first aspects mentioned. The other 50% of achievement relies on students themselves, their own evaluation towards what they have created with the guide of the teacher to boost accomplishment in all the aspects a good piece of writing requires.     Among other the limitations of this application is that it does not work on all devices. There is only one important one missing and that is the Word add-in for MacOS if we talk about commercial suites. There is also no add-in for suites like OpenOffice or LibreOffice.Also, its free version is very limited, it only has one function, correcting spelling and grammar. While this may seem like a major disadvantage to some, it is perfectly acceptable to others.

    You should also know that your level of English must be good as If you write sentences or texts with many errors, it is possible that the software does not interpret correctly what you want to say and the result will not be satisfactory.
